Krylon makes a spray-on magnetic board paint that's mostly iron particles. Word is that it's very conductive and makes a good spray on shield.

I've found that the 3M copper tape with conductive adhesive is very easy to use. My other choice is .005" brass shim stock of the sort sold in hobby shops- I picked up a bunch cheap on Ebay.

I was wondering... can you play an upright through a electric bass amp? Well, I'm sure it won't hurt the speaker, but will it sound bad?
 
Check the input impedance on your bass amp. If it is 1 MegOhm or higher, you are good to go. Otherwise, you need a preamp. What kind of amp is it?

You won't damage the amp, but you also won't get the best sound if your amp has a lower input impedance. It alters the frequency response in a way that: a) Makes your bass sound worse; b) increases feedback problems.

The preamp needn't be fancy, and it doesn't even need any knobs -- its main job is to go from the high-Z output of your pickup to the lower-Z input of your bass amp.

I've lately been building the phantom-powered version of the Don Tillman preamp right onto the sensor. You only need to put a transistor and two resistors there, which doesn't take up much room, and you can plug stright into a phantom powered front end, or a battery box. The preamp gives you 6dB of gain, too, which these film MSI sensors really need.

The ideal way to do it woiuld be using surface-mount componants. I've been trying to do this with some surface-mount J201 FETs I bought, but even with the 13 watt soldering iron, a 1/16" tip, and my fly tying skills I can't quite do it. We'll see.
